    C/C pens lend themselves to this kind of thing. A piston filler fountain pen, though, has no path from a rollerball. Rollerbal has no blind cap. You'd have to acquire piston filler parts or a section for a cartridge or converter. What's the motivation for a company like Montblanc that probably takes a dim view of such conversions -- cheapens the line, not high end enough.
